We're all searching for a connection, something to tether us to another. Most of us only get one shot at finding a love that will last a lifetime. For some, it's found in the arms of a lover. For some, it's found in the soul of a friend. But the ones who are truly lucky find it in both.

Calliope Davies was never taught to love herself, or understand why anyone else would ever love her. The only relationship that ever came easily to her is the one she has with her two best friends.

Willem Berg has spent the last six years of his life away from the only woman who has ever been in his heart. Now he's coming home, and he is desperate to save her from a monster and from herself.

Together they will discover just how strong you can be when you are tied by fear but bound by love.

This is the debut novel by D. E. Bond. And it is AMAZING! **Beware** This book will leave you with a book hangover like no other! But in the best possible way!




I was sucked in within the first paragraph. This novel is a dark twisted romantic novel that will take you on a roller coaster ride. I seriously became obsessed with the characters and the story. The first night I read this, I stopped to get to bed and found myself saying prayers for the Cali and Will, the fictional characters of this novel. Cali and Will are first loves, but after six years of separation when Will left for California and Cali stayed behind in Phili to open a bakery with her best friend. Fast forward six years and Will is almost wrapped up in CA and ready to head home, back to his girl Cali. However, Cali is in a relationship with Kurt.




Will will do anything to get Cali back, and he has no idea who Cali is actually involved with. This novel is dark, and dangerous, and makes you fall in love with Will. I had so much concern and fear for the situation Cali was in that I prayed Will could rescue her. This fast past novel, was dark and dangerous with nostalgic parts. The character development was so well developed I felt like the characters were all friends. I definitely can not wait for the next novel.
